The GIGABYTE GeForce GTX 1660 TI D6 6G is based on the NVIDIA GeForce GTX 1660 Ti (Turing) and has 6 GB GDDR6 graphics memory with a bandwidth of 288 GB/s.

The INNO3D GeForce RTX 3050 Twin X2 OC is based on the NVIDIA GeForce RTX 3050 (Ampere) and has 8 GB GDDR6 graphics memory with a bandwidth of 224 GB/s.

GPU

The GIGABYTE GeForce GTX 1660 TI D6 6G has the TU116-400-A1 graphics chip installed, which is based on the Turing architecture.

The INNO3D GeForce RTX 3050 Twin X2 OC is based on the graphics chip GA106-150-A1, which comes from the Ampere architecture.

The graphics memory of the GIGABYTE GeForce GTX 1660 TI D6 6G clocks at 1.500 GHz, which corresponds to a speed of 12.0 Gbps.

The graphics memory speed of the INNO3D GeForce RTX 3050 Twin X2 OC is 14.0 Gbps and the clock speed is 1.750 GHz.

The GIGABYTE GeForce GTX 1660 TI D6 6G is powered by 1 x 8-Pin connectors. The TDP (Thermal Design Power) of the graphics card is 120 W.

The INNO3D GeForce RTX 3050 Twin X2 OC has 1 x 8-Pin PCIe power connectors that supply it with energy. The manufacturer specifies the TDP of the card as 130 W.
